First Half Marathon!

Well we did it!

Three weeks ago after our "Extreme Fitness boot camp" we decided to give it a shot.
We spent a few weekday mornings running before the sun came up,
Saturday mornings again..running before the sun came up,
last Saturday we ran 10 1/2 miles but that was the furthest we've ran.

Friday night we got together and had some garlic biscuits,salad, chicken Alfredo pasta
& lots of water.

Race Day:
Julie picked me up around 4:30 and we headed on over to the race that was about an
hour away. Got there, picked up our packets and started getting the race jitters.

Every forecast said it was going to be rainy and upper 50's to 60's,
as the sun started to rise there wasn't a cloud in the sky. We couldn't have asked for  more perfect
race weather!

At opening Ceremonies they had a Chaplain say a prayer over our troops, deployed, injured,
stateside and their families, the racers and the race. Then there was a second grade class that presented small American flags to some Wounded Warriors on stage that would be hand-cycling the race while a song about thanking the Troops for their service played through out the stadium. It was a beautiful thing.

To be apart of such a great organization, among people who support the troops was wonderful.
We took off and before we knew it we started passing mile markers like crazy, we even kept a really good pace. At mile 6 we took the Rehydrate gel but didn't stop, no time to stop! There were people along the way holding signs, just watching,cheering you on & being friendly!

We crossed the finish line at 1:59:50,got finishers medals  and my sweet friend Leah was there to capture this moment for us so we could share it with our husbands!
